Transaction fea80d76660827af71dd42b3d1cba39e9c41fb8bcbd626b914f50fc4b520239f
1 Input
1 Output
-
fea80d76660827af71dd42b3d1cba39e9c41fb8bcbd626b914f50fc4b520239f:0
- value
- 8613477
- script pubkey
- OP_0 OP_PUSHBYTES_20 12039fbb32baef71a0a6ca86d2d472f204bf8d4e
- address
- bc1qzgpelwejhthhrg9xe2rd94rj7gztlr2wehfqn0